The retirement of the long-term landlady has given Punch their excuse to take this over in their managed “Unity Social” group. So, a pub famous for being one of the few in town with no TVs or deafening music is now being promoted as “your home for live sport and entertainment”. Actually a relatively tasteful refurb inside besides the very unwelcome addition of three massive TVs - sadly ale has been slashed to two handpulls currently serving only Wainwrights. With regret, I it’s farewell to one of Liverpool’s most characterful old pubs, now just yet another 5/10 chain sports pub.

The Globe was closed when I tried to visit early on a Monday evening in February, but I was happy to find it open at around the same time on bank holiday Monday just gone. This is certainly a small pub with banquettes on carpet across the front window and up the left-hand wall to around the rear. A partition screen, with a stained glass insert, is found three quarters of the way up the left hand banquettes creating front and rear seating. The serving counter on the right-hand wall has a tile floored surround and there’s more stained glass around the top of the bar. Standard keg was available alongside Madri and Cruzcampo and four of the five hand pumps were in use drawing Brain’s Rev James, TT Landlord and Boltmaker and Wainwright. The Rev James, served by the friendly landlady, was on good form.
In the rear, on the way to the gents, is a small wooden floored seating area with some tables and a short banquette up the left. A map of Liverpool patterned wallpaper covers the right-hand wall and there’s a small coal fire that was primed for lighting on the rear wall. This is a proper old boozer with an older clientele from at least the 1960s where the background music was from. Worth a look.

My tweet about "never judging a book by its cover" was retweeted by Roger Protz who commented that Liverpool CAMRA first met there 50 years ago next year.
I went viral :-)
What a gem - externally, it looks like you should be walking on by, but inside, its a proper pub that you instantly feel at home in. Small front room around a horseshoe bar. A 2nd, almost secluded back room. Full of puppy trinkets and art work.
TT Boltmaker in fine condition - the pumps for this and landlord emblazoned with the brewery "champion cellar" accreditation.
